Solar energy collectors will be installed on up to 60 acres at O'Hare International Airport, and a service station selling alternative fuels for private and commercial vehicles will open near the airport, Chicago's aviation chief announced Monday.
The company that lost the concession contract at O'Hare International Airport's international terminal sued today, arguing the new firm will shortchange the city by tens of millions of dollars and was picked through a bidding process that violated state law.
Tolls would almost double for motorists as part of a 15-year, $12.1 billion capital plan that includes extending the Elgin-O'Hare Expressway and building a western bypass around O'Hare International Airport, and widening and rebuilding I-90.
